> On Tue, Aug 5, 2008 at 2:50 PM, David York <[EMAIL PROTECTED]> wrote:
>> Does anybody know how to find the real IP address (e.g.: address
>> visible to internet) of a machine via Python?  In other words I have a
>> machine with an IP address something like 192.168.1.5, an address given
>> to me by a router. The router's address (and thus my machine's address)
>> to the outside world is something realistic, 123.156.123.156 or
>> whatever.  How do I get that number?  I've tried
>> socket.getaddrinfo('localhost', None) but all I get is 127.0.0.1 as
>> expected.
>>
>> How do I find out my machine's IP address as visible to the outside
>> world? Thanks a lot.

> I'm not sure what you are trying to accomplish. The machine I'm typing
> this on has a 192.168.x.x number. The router that gave it to me also has
> a 192.168.x.x number. However, I know that that is not the IP that the
> world sees when my packets finally leave the building.

That's the IP address the OP probably wants. At least, when I've asked 
this exact same question, that's what I meant.

The only way I know of is to query an external server that will tell you. 
There's a few of them out there. Here's a few:

http://checkip.dyndns.org/
http://www.showmyip.com
http://www.showmyip.com/simple/
http://whatismyip.org/

The basic algorithm is to connect to one of those sites and fetch the 
data it returns, then parse it appropriately. Some of them return a 
simple IP address, some a complicated bunch of text, some a nicely 
formatted XML document. Some of them only allow you to query the server a 
limited number of times. I don't remember which is which.

To get you started, here's an untested piece of code:

import urllib2
import re
data = urllib2.urlopen(site).read()
matcher = re.compile(r"\d{1,3}\.\d{1,3}\.\d{1,3}\.\d{1,3}")
ip_address = matcher.search(data).group()
